ABSTRACT:
A hybrid scheme for controlling transmission errors in digital data communication systems. Normally, data blocks with a small number of parity digits for error detection are transmitted. When the presence of errors is detected, the retransmissions are not the original data blocks but some properly selected blocks for correcting errors in those erroneously received data blocks which are stored in a buffer at the receiver. The retransmitted blocks are formed based on the original data blocks and error-correcting codes with an invertible property. When such blocks are received, they are used to recover the original data blocks either by an inversion operation or by a decoding process.
